download 这个文件。https://github.com/tpope/vim-pathogen github上的
更加详细,还有readme文档。。
2. mkdir -p 选项。表示可以建立上层目录。
例如 mkdir -p /root/tset/abc
如果root下面没有test文件夹,在创立abc的时候会创建。如果不使用-p选项,只能
在/root下首先建立mkdir test 文件夹,然后才能在test下mkdir abc。
curl的用法。这篇文章里有。。
http://blog.chinaunix.net/space.php?uid=24701781&do=blog&id=3340359
curl -so 的意思:
-o 是下载,-s 是静音模式。
官方的install
----------------------------------------------------------------------------------------------------------------------------------
Install to ~/.vim/autoload/pathogen.vim. Or copy and paste:
mkdir -p ~/.vim/autoload ~/.vim/bundle; \curl -so ~/.vim/autoload/pathogen.vim \ https://raw.github.com/tpope/vim-pathogen/master/autoload/pathogen.vimIf you don't have curl, use wget -O - instead.
By the way, if you're using Windows, change all occurrences of ~/.vimto ~\vimfiles.
------------------------------------------------------------------------------------------------------------------------------------其实就是把pathogen cp到~/.vim/autoload里就好了。。
第二步:
Add this to your vimrc:
call pathogen#infect()第三步:
将所有的插件放到~/.vim/bundle中(windows是/vimfiles/bundle),比如安装ZenCoding这个插件,在官网上下载插件后,进入bundle文件夹,新建文件夹,命名为ZenCoding(当然名字不是强制为插件名称的,可以设置为任何容易识别的名称),然后将压缩包内容全部解压到该文件夹中即可。
--------------------------------------------------------------------------------
官网举例子是:
cd ~/.vim/bundlegit clone git://github.com/tpope/vim-fugitive.gitNow fugitive.vim is installed.If you really want to get crazy, you could set it up as a submodule inwhatever repository you keep your dot files in. I don't like to getcrazy.
第四步:
打开Vim,Enjoy~
如果需要生成文档,只需要在Vim input.
:call pathogen#helptags()
即可。
定制:
如果不想以/bundle作为插件的路径,比如想以~/.vim/addons作为插件目录,那么只需将
call pathogen#infect()
替换为
替换为
call pathogen#infect("addons")
即可,当然,如果不想将插件放在~/.vim目录中,也可以在括号内填入完整路径:
call pathogen#infect('~/src/vim/bundle')
这样,如果将插件放入~/src/vim/bundle中,pathogen就可以找到了。
其他:
既然其他插件能够被安装到别的目录下,那么pathogen本身作为一个插件是否也可以安装到别的目录下呢?
当然可以。
如果希望pathogen和其他插件一样安装在~/.vim/bundle中,只需在.vimrc中加入:
即可。
总体来说,simple tool.